Baitus Salam
This temporary shelter for Asnaf Muallaf operates as a community centre for them to reorganise the life direction of a convert upon embracing Islam or when something untoward has happened to him/her. It aims to transform the welfare of Muallaf in Selangor.
Objective Baitus Salam
- In accordance with Part V of the Registration, Care and Teaching for Muallafs (State of Selangor) Regulations 2009
- Acts as a shelter for Muallaf who have been shunned by their family/relatives after embracing Islam
- To protect Muallaf from external threats including from their families
- Acts as a short-term Fardhu Ain guidance centre for Muallaf
- Provide vocational knowledge to better their socioeconomic situation
- A place to reorganise themselves emotionally and socially for a better life ahead
- To preserve his/her Akidah from being distorted by any other parties
What are the eligibility requirements of Baitus Salam?
- A citizen of Malaysia
- Attend the programmes/activities/lectures at Baitis Salam on a full-time basis for 1 year
- Within the maximum period of 5 years whereby newly converted brothers and sisters are called Muallaf, as per Section 47 of the Administration of the Religion of Islam (State of Selangor) Enactment 2003
- Of good health and free of contagious diseases such as AIDS and addiction to drugs and/or alcohol
- No serious mental stress issues
- Not subject to any court/criminal matters or proceedings
- Voluntarily applied to join Baitus Salam and prepared to comply to rules and regulations set by its management
